On this episode of Stories from the Dawn of Online Identity, our signal finds a distant station carrying a fascinating broadcast—a room, a camera, and a life left running. In the mid 1990s, Jennifer Ringley pointed a webcam at her dorm room and walked away.
No script. No performance. No explanation. Just time passing, uninterrupted.
Then, one day, the camera went dark.
